International recognition means that a medical degree may support graduates in applying for professional registration, postgraduate training or licensing procedures in different countries.
This does not mean that every country follows the same process. Medical graduates often need to complete national requirements, such as licensing examinations, internships, language requirements or registration procedures.

UCAT is not required to apply for the Medicine programme at MediCampus Europeo faculty of Medicine in Malta.
Unlike many medical school admissions systems that rely heavily on a single external test, MCE follows a structured admissions process designed to assess academic preparation, motivation and suitability for medical studies.

The admissions process at MediCampus Europeo is clear and structured, guiding applicants from the first online application to final enrolment.
Applicants begin by completing the online application form and submitting their academic documents.
This first step allows the admissions team to review the student’s educational background and verify the initial application requirements.
Applicants then take part in a short online admission session, which includes a motivational interview.
This stage helps MCE understand the student’s motivation, academic profile and readiness to begin a demanding medical degree.
Applicants who successfully complete the Admission Assessment may receive a Conditional Offer of Admission.
By accepting the Conditional Offer, students secure their place in the programme and proceed to the final stage of the admissions process.
The final academic validation is conducted by the awarding university, Trakia University.
This stage confirms the applicant’s fundamental knowledge in the key areas required to begin medical studies.
